Dwarf-spheroidal satellites: are they of tidal origin?
Abstract
The Milky Way and Andromeda must have formed through an initial epoch of sub-structure merging. As a result of fundamental physical conservation laws tidal-dwarf galaxies (TDGs) have likely been produced. Here we show that such TDGs appear, after a Hubble-time of dynamical evolution in the host dark-matter halo, as objects that resemble known dSph satellite galaxies. We discuss the possibility that some of the Milky Way's satellites may be of tidal origin.
